Focus on transparency, community contact and open discussion.Modular development approach: 3 main parts, 2 are feature complete.Funded by preorders, 14000 sales before Steam Early Access.4 years of full-time development so far.Any major problems with these milestones are addressed quickly in hotfixes before we move on to the next milestone. Our development process focuses on milestone builds that introduce new features every ~3-4 months and are both beta-tested and reasonably polished-up. We're not known for being good with estimates, but always deliver and are good at avoiding feature creep. Rest assured that we are confident of finishing all the promised features of Automation, even if it may take quite some time. This may seem like a lot, but a complex game like Automation takes a small team a long time to make to the standard we do. “Completing the game and adding all content promised will likely take several years.

It also allows us to get additional manpower to the team to tackle the huge job of game balancing and AI programming. Previously we offered an early access version of the game via our website, but this sales platform and distribution channel has been outgrown by the steadily increasing interest in the game, becoming complicated to manage for a small team like ours.įinally launching the game on Steam Early Access makes possible to speed up development with any additional income, allowing for quicker content addition (car bodies, engines, etc.) than otherwise possible. We also wanted to make sure we can offer enough content and polish to warrant presenting and selling the game to a larger audience. “We held back on launching Automation into Early Access until the game had a solid, fleshed-out core which the main tycoon part of the game will be based on.
